The Ooty Flower Festival, a beloved annual event in Tamil Nadu, draws visitors from all over India to celebrate the beauty of flowers at the Botanical Garden. Known for its colorful and lively atmosphere, this festival is a highlight for nature lovers and cultural enthusiasts alike.

Historical Significance

Since its inception in 1896, the Ooty Flower Festival has become a key event for flower aficionados. Each year, approximately 250 exhibitors showcase over 150 types of flowers, attracting hundreds of thousands of visitors.

More Than Just Flowers

Alongside the Flower Show, the Ooty Summer Festival includes other events like the Fruit Show, Vegetable Show, Rose Show, and Spice Show. These additional attractions make Ooty a bustling center of activity during the festival period.
